Step-by-Step: How to Obtain a Polish Driver's License
For first-time drivers, the journey to getting a license includes a number of unique milestones. The procedure is strictly managed to make sure high requirements of roadway security.
1. Acquire a PKK Number (Profil Kandydata na Kierowcę)
Before taking any driving lessons or Polskie Prawo Jazdy Dla Obcokrajowców booking a test, an applicant needs to visit the regional communication office to produce a PKK (Candidate Driver Profile). This is an unique electronic identification number that tracks a candidate's progress through the licensing system.

3. Pass the State Exams
After finishing the driving school curriculum, candidates should pass two different exams administered by WORD (Wojewódzki Ośrodek Ruchu Drogowego):
4. Gather the License
Upon passing both examinations, the WORD center updates the system digitally. The candidate needs to then go back to the local Polish Drivers License Agency, pay the issuance cost, and wait around 2 to 3 weeks for the physical card to be printed and prepared for pickup.
Exchanging a Foreign License for a Polish One
Poland has particular guidelines relating to foreign motorist's licenses. Depending on the provider of the initial license, the exchange procedure varies significantly.
Origin of Foreign LicenseRequirement for Wymagania DotycząCe Polskiego Prawa Jazdy Use in PolandNeed to Exchange?EU/ EFTA Member StatesValid up until its expiration date.Optional (unless lost or harmed).Vienna Convention SignatoriesLegitimate for approximately 185 days after developing residency.Mandatory after 185 days of residency.Non-Vienna Convention CountriesValid for as much as 185 days (often requires an International Driving Permit).Necessary; usually requires passing the theoretical examination.
Note: Non-EU/EFTA applicants exchanging their licenses typically need to provide a sworn translation of their foreign license, a medical certificate, and evidence of legal residency.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I take the Polish driving theory examination in English?
Yes. Major provincial traffic centers (WORD) use the theoretical test in English, German, and Russian. However, the practical examination must be carried out in Polish, though you are lawfully enabled to bring a qualified translator inside the car with you.
For how long does it take to get the physical motorist's license card?
As soon as the application is formally authorized by the regional interaction office-- and supplied you have actually passed your exams-- it typically takes between 2 to 3 weeks for the card to be printed and provided to the workplace.
Do I require to speak Polish to visit the Drivers License Agency?
It is greatly suggested to bring someone who speaks Polish if you are checking out a regional Starostwo Powiatowe. In bigger cosmopolitan Urząd Miasta branches, English help is more common, however main application forms are strictly in Polish.
What is the minimum age to get a Category B (Car) license in Poland?
The minimum age to obtain a standard car driver's license in Poland is 18 years old. However, you can begin taking theoretical classes and get your PKK three months before your 18th birthday.
